Summary
In this episode of the Graymatter podcast, James Gray interviews Chris Tidrick, CIO at Gies College of Business, discussing the critical aspects of leadership in IT. Chris emphasizes the importance of understanding the people side of technology leadership, the significance of hiring individuals with strong interpersonal skills, and the need for leaders to support and uplift their teams.
The conversation explores how to select leaders, the cultural norms that foster effective leadership, and the balance between technical expertise and management skills. Chris shares insights on promoting growth within teams and the importance of candid conversations about career paths in technology. In this conversation, Chris Tidrick shares insights on leadership, team dynamics, and transitioning from a technical role to a leadership position. He emphasizes the importance of supporting teams, understanding client needs, and building organizational relationships.
Tidrick also discusses the significance of communication and storytelling in IT and the need for personal creative outlets to maintain fulfillment in leadership roles. In this conversation, Chris Tidrick and James Gray explore the intersection of leadership, creativity, and technology. They discuss embracing creativity beyond work, finding personal fulfillment, and transitioning from self-focused to other-focused leadership. Tidrick emphasizes the value of leadership training and how AI can serve as a powerful tool for personal and professional growth, ultimately highlighting that the future of IT is about people, not just technology.
Takeaways
Leadership in IT requires a balance of technical skills and emotional intelligence.
Hiring for leadership roles should prioritize interpersonal skills over technical expertise.
It's essential to understand the business context in which technology operates.
Candid conversations build trust and transparency within teams.
Transitioning from a technical role to leadership can be challenging but rewarding.
AI can serve as a valuable tool for leaders to enhance their decision-making.
Creating a supportive environment is crucial for team success.
Leaders should focus on uplifting their team members.
Understanding team dynamics can help resolve conflicts effectively.
The future of IT leadership will increasingly focus on people rather than technology.
